As a director and theatre maker Edwards has toured internationally for over thirty years producing original work for performance in new writing, classic adaptation, visual theatre, site-based performance, music theatre and film. He holds a Readership in the Centre for Contemporary and Digital Performance at the University, and co-founded and co-edits the on-line journal Body, Space + Technology (BST Journal).

He has been Artistic Director of four companies, and currently is director of the performance group Optik (www.optik.tv), the industry initiative PI Network (www.performanceinitiatives.organd is a director of the production company ScenePool (www.scenepool.co.uk).

Edwards’ performance work is reviewed extensively, and been the subject of analysis by leading commentators that include Sue Broadhurst, John Keefe, Susan Melrose, Patrice Pavis, Tracey Warr, and others.

His recent theatre work has been performed in Sao Paulo, Belgrade, Montréal, Sofia, Helsinki and London. The film Shiver, a collaboration with poet Andrea Brady and artist Nada Stevanovic, premiered at Shunt London in June 2007.

 

KEY RESEARCH INTERESTS

Specialism: directing practice and performance composition.

Performance production research into:

  • directing practice and theatre composition.
  • content development
  • performer techniques
  • interactive and integrated systems (sound, video)
  • new theatre writing
